The renewal of our three-year agreement with Torvane Materials has been assessed in detail. Proposed terms include a 4.2% unit-price increase, partially offset by improved volume rebates and extended payment terms of sixty days. Sensitivity analysis indicates a net annual cost impact of under 1% on the Meridia product line, assuming stable demand. Legal has flagged no material changes to liability clauses. We recommend approval, subject to the conditions outlined in the confidential note below.

confidential, yawip-bahif: Zorokox Partners plans to lower the Casax list price by 28.0 percent in April. The board signed off on a budget of $271.0 million for Project Juldor. The renewal with Pelokox Partners closes at $410.1 million a year, 3.4 percent below the last contract. Project Pelok slips by a full year because of the audit delay.

Runbook 4.3 — Publishing the Brackenwiki release

After merge, confirm the role-based access migration ran: the editor, reviewer, and admin roles must exist, and legacy contributor accounts should map to editor. Spot-check that a reviewer account can approve but not publish, and that anonymous users see only public spaces. Code reviewers should verify the permission matrix in the migration diff matches the table in the spec before sign-off. Once access checks pass, tag the release and sign it. Use the signing key below.

signing key of bagap-yawep = bky13_TbfT6ZMUoGJo2

## Deployment

The Lumacache image service has a known slow leak in its thumbnail cache layer: evicted entries keep a reference alive through the decoder pool, so resident memory creeps up roughly 40 MB per hour under steady load. Until the refactor in the Harkness branch lands, we mitigate by capping pool size and scheduling a rolling restart every 12 hours. Deploy with the supervisor, never bare, or the restart hook won't fire. The deployment relies on the configuration values listed below.

settings of bagug-tahof:
holath:
  pin: 7837
  metrics_host: metrics.holath.tolvaqsys.internal
  tenant: quenath
  seal: seal_6001b3af